容器化部署已经成为现代应用开发和运维的核心技术之一。它通过将应用程序及其依赖打包成独立的容器,实现了环境的一致性和部署的高效性。然而,仅仅使用容器还不够,服务器资源的优化同样至关重要。
在容器化环境中,合理分配CPU和内存资源可以显著提升性能。过多的资源分配会导致浪费,而过少则可能引发性能瓶颈。因此,根据实际负载动态调整资源配额是关键。同时,利用容器编排工具如Kubernetes,可以实现自动化的资源调度和弹性伸缩。
另一方面,容器镜像的精简也是优化的重要环节。冗余的文件和不必要的软件包会增加镜像体积,影响拉取速度和运行效率。通过多阶段构建、删除临时文件等方式,可以有效减小镜像大小,提高部署速度。

AI模拟效果图,仅供参考
网络配置同样不可忽视。容器间的通信需要高效的网络策略支持,合理的网络隔离和负载均衡能够减少延迟,提升整体系统的稳定性。•使用轻量级的网络插件也能降低系统开销。
•监控和日志管理是持续优化的基础。通过收集容器运行时的性能指标和日志信息,可以及时发现潜在问题并进行调整。结合自动化工具,可以实现对容器化服务的实时监控与快速响应。